
Understanding which exercise machines target specific muscle groups is essential for creating an effective workout routine. Different machines are designed to isolate and engage particular muscles, allowing for targeted strength training and conditioning. For instance, the treadmill primarily works the lower body, including the quadriceps, hamstrings, and calves, while the rowing machine provides a full-body workout, engaging the arms, back, core, and legs. Similarly, the chest press machine focuses on the pectoralis muscles and triceps, whereas the lat pulldown machine targets the latissimus dorsi in the back. Knowing how each machine functions enables individuals to tailor their workouts to meet specific fitness goals, whether it's building muscle, improving endurance, or enhancing overall strength.

Treadmills and Ellipticals: Target legs, glutes, core, and cardiovascular system; low-impact options available
Treadmills and ellipticals are cornerstone machines in any gym, designed to engage multiple muscle groups while boosting cardiovascular health. Both target the legs, glutes, and core, but they do so with distinct mechanics. Treadmills primarily work the quadriceps, hamstrings, and calves through walking, jogging, or running. Incline settings amplify glute activation, while maintaining proper posture engages the core. Ellipticals, on the other hand, offer a full-leg workout by incorporating a pushing and pulling motion, hitting the glutes, quads, hamstrings, and even the calves and tibialis anterior. Both machines elevate heart rate, improving cardiovascular endurance, but ellipticals provide a low-impact alternative, reducing joint stress for users with knee or hip concerns.
For optimal results, incorporate these machines into a balanced routine. Beginners should start with 20–30 minutes of moderate-intensity treadmill walking or elliptical use, 3–4 times per week. Intermediate users can increase duration to 30–45 minutes, adding intervals or incline challenges. Advanced users might alternate between high-intensity treadmill sprints and elliptical resistance workouts to maximize muscle engagement and calorie burn. A practical tip: maintain an upright posture on both machines to ensure core activation and prevent strain. For ellipticals, avoid leaning on the handles excessively, as this reduces core involvement and limits the workout’s effectiveness.
The low-impact nature of ellipticals makes them particularly appealing for older adults, individuals recovering from injury, or those with joint sensitivities. Studies show that elliptical training can improve lower body strength and cardiovascular fitness without the repetitive impact of treadmill running. Treadmills, however, offer versatility through speed and incline adjustments, making them ideal for high-intensity interval training (HIIT) or endurance-focused workouts. For instance, a 10% incline at a moderate pace can burn up to 30% more calories than walking on a flat surface, while engaging the glutes and hamstrings more intensely.
A comparative analysis reveals that while both machines target similar muscle groups, the choice depends on individual goals and physical condition. Treadmills excel in calorie burning and bone density improvement due to their weight-bearing nature, making them suitable for younger, healthier users. Ellipticals, with their fluid motion, are gentler on joints and provide a more balanced lower body workout, ideal for long-term sustainability. Combining both machines in a weekly routine can offer the best of both worlds: the intensity of treadmill workouts and the joint-friendly benefits of ellipticals.
Incorporating treadmills and ellipticals into your fitness regimen requires mindful usage. Start with a 5-minute warm-up at a slow pace to prepare muscles and joints. Gradually increase intensity, and always cool down with 5 minutes of low-impact movement. For those over 50 or with pre-existing conditions, consult a physician before starting a new routine. Practical accessories like supportive shoes and a water bottle can enhance comfort and hydration during workouts. By understanding the unique benefits of each machine, users can tailor their approach to meet specific fitness goals while minimizing injury risk.

Rowing Machines: Work upper and lower body, including back, arms, and legs
Rowing machines are a powerhouse of full-body engagement, targeting both upper and lower body muscles in a single, fluid motion. Unlike isolated exercises, rowing mimics the natural movement of pulling and pushing, activating multiple muscle groups simultaneously. The primary muscles at work include the latissimus dorsi (back), quadriceps and hamstrings (legs), and the biceps and forearms (arms). This holistic approach not only builds strength but also improves cardiovascular endurance, making it an efficient choice for those seeking a comprehensive workout.
To maximize the benefits of a rowing machine, focus on proper form. Begin by sitting on the machine with your feet securely strapped and knees bent. Grab the handle with a firm grip, keeping your elbows relaxed. Initiate the movement by pushing through your legs, engaging your core, and then pulling the handle toward your chest while maintaining a straight back. This sequence ensures that the workload is distributed evenly across your back, arms, and legs. Aim for 20–30 minutes of rowing, 3–4 times a week, to see noticeable improvements in muscle tone and endurance.
One of the standout advantages of rowing machines is their low-impact nature, making them suitable for individuals of all ages, including older adults or those recovering from injuries. Unlike high-impact exercises like running, rowing minimizes stress on joints while still delivering a robust workout. For beginners, start with shorter sessions of 10–15 minutes and gradually increase duration and intensity. Incorporate interval training—alternating between high-intensity bursts and slower recovery periods—to enhance calorie burn and muscle engagement.
Comparatively, rowing machines offer a more balanced workout than machines like treadmills or stationary bikes, which primarily focus on the lower body. The rhythmic, repetitive motion of rowing not only strengthens muscles but also improves posture and flexibility, particularly in the spine and shoulders. For added variety, experiment with different resistance levels to challenge your muscles in new ways. Pairing rowing with core exercises like planks or Russian twists can further amplify results, creating a well-rounded fitness routine.
Incorporating a rowing machine into your regimen is a practical, time-efficient way to target multiple muscle groups without needing a gym full of equipment. Whether you’re a fitness novice or an experienced athlete, the versatility of this machine ensures it remains a valuable tool in your workout arsenal. Remember, consistency is key—regular use will yield stronger muscles, better endurance, and a more balanced physique. Stationary Bikes: Focus on quadriceps, hamstrings, calves, and cardiovascular endurance
Stationary bikes are a staple in gyms and home workouts for good reason: they target key lower body muscles while boosting cardiovascular endurance. The pedaling motion primarily engages the quadriceps, the powerhouse muscles at the front of your thighs, which extend your knee with each downward push. Simultaneously, the hamstrings, located at the back of your thighs, work in tandem to flex the knee as you lift the pedal. This continuous push-and-pull action creates a balanced workout for both muscle groups, enhancing strength and definition over time.
Beyond the quadriceps and hamstrings, stationary bikes also activate the calves. The gastrocnemius and soleus muscles, responsible for plantar flexion (pointing your toes downward), are engaged as you press down on the pedals. This not only sculpts the lower legs but also improves ankle stability. For optimal calf engagement, adjust the bike’s resistance to a higher level and focus on pushing through the balls of your feet during each revolution. Incorporating interval training—alternating between high resistance and low resistance—can further amplify calf activation while boosting cardiovascular benefits.
Cardiovascular endurance is another major advantage of stationary bikes. Consistent pedaling elevates your heart rate, improving blood circulation and lung capacity. Aim for 30–60 minutes of moderate to vigorous cycling, 3–5 times per week, to see significant improvements in endurance. Beginners should start with shorter sessions and gradually increase duration and intensity. Advanced users can incorporate high-intensity interval training (HIIT), cycling at maximum effort for 30 seconds followed by 1–2 minutes of recovery, to push their limits and burn more calories.
Practical tips can maximize the effectiveness of your stationary bike workouts. Ensure proper bike setup: adjust the seat height so your knee is slightly bent at the bottom of the pedal stroke, and position the handlebars for a comfortable, upright posture. Wear cycling shoes or secure sneakers to prevent slipping. For those over 50 or with joint concerns, stationary bikes offer a low-impact alternative to running, reducing stress on knees and hips while still delivering a robust workout. Finally, track your progress using built-in metrics like distance, speed, and calories burned to stay motivated and measure improvements.
In summary, stationary bikes are a versatile tool for targeting the quadriceps, hamstrings, and calves while simultaneously enhancing cardiovascular endurance. By adjusting resistance, incorporating intervals, and maintaining proper form, users of all fitness levels can achieve strength, endurance, and calorie-burning goals. Whether you’re a beginner or a seasoned athlete, the stationary bike remains a reliable, efficient, and accessible option for full-body fitness.

Cable Machines: Isolate specific muscles like biceps, triceps, shoulders, and back
Cable machines are a versatile tool in any gym, offering a unique advantage: the ability to isolate and target specific muscle groups with precision. Unlike free weights, which engage multiple muscles simultaneously, cable machines allow for controlled, unilateral movements that focus tension on a single area. This makes them ideal for both strength training and rehabilitation, as they enable users to address muscle imbalances or weaknesses without overloading other parts of the body. For instance, a simple bicep curl using a cable machine ensures constant tension throughout the movement, maximizing muscle engagement compared to traditional dumbbells.
To effectively isolate muscles like the biceps, triceps, shoulders, and back, start by adjusting the cable height to align with the target muscle. For biceps, set the cable at the lowest position and use a single-arm curl, ensuring your elbow remains stationary. Aim for 3 sets of 12–15 reps, focusing on the contraction at the top of the movement. For triceps, attach a rope or straight bar to the high pulley and perform tricep pushdowns, keeping your elbows close to your body. Maintain a steady tempo, taking 2 seconds to lower and 2 seconds to push the weight back up. This controlled approach ensures optimal muscle activation.
Shoulder exercises on a cable machine can be particularly effective for building strength and stability. For lateral raises, set the cable at mid-height and stand sideways to the machine, pulling the handle away from the stack while keeping your arm straight. This isolates the medial deltoid without engaging the traps or back muscles. Similarly, for the back, a seated row with a V-bar attachment targets the latissimus dorsi and rhomboids. Sit upright, pull the cable toward your torso, and squeeze your shoulder blades together at the peak of the movement. Aim for 4 sets of 8–12 reps to build both strength and endurance.
One of the key benefits of cable machines is their ability to provide continuous tension, which is crucial for muscle hypertrophy. Unlike free weights, where tension decreases at certain points in the lift, cables maintain resistance throughout the entire range of motion. This makes them particularly effective for advanced lifters looking to break plateaus or beginners seeking to build a solid foundation. However, proper form is critical to avoid injury. Always maintain a neutral spine, engage your core, and avoid jerking or bouncing the weight.
Incorporating cable machines into your routine doesn’t require hours in the gym. A 20–30 minute session, 2–3 times per week, can yield significant results when paired with proper nutrition and recovery. For older adults or those with joint issues, cables offer a low-impact alternative to heavy lifting, reducing the risk of strain while still providing a challenging workout. Whether you’re targeting specific muscle groups or aiming for balanced development, cable machines are a powerful tool to add to your fitness arsenal.

Leg Press Machines: Strengthen quadriceps, hamstrings, glutes, and calves effectively
The leg press machine is a powerhouse for lower body strength, targeting multiple muscle groups in a single, controlled motion. By pushing a platform loaded with weight, users engage their quadriceps, hamstrings, glutes, and calves simultaneously, making it an efficient tool for comprehensive leg development. Unlike free-weight squats, the leg press machine provides a fixed plane of motion, reducing the risk of imbalance and allowing individuals of varying fitness levels to safely increase resistance. This makes it particularly appealing for beginners, older adults, or those recovering from injuries who need a stable, guided exercise.
To maximize effectiveness, proper form is critical. Start by adjusting the seat so your legs form a 90-degree angle at the knees when your feet are flat on the platform. Position your feet shoulder-width apart, slightly higher on the platform to emphasize quadriceps engagement, or lower to shift focus to the hamstrings and glutes. Gradually lower the platform until your knees are at a 90-degree angle, then push through your heels to return to the starting position, maintaining control throughout. Aim for 3 sets of 8–12 repetitions, adjusting weight to challenge your muscles without compromising form.
While the leg press machine is versatile, it’s not without limitations. Overloading the machine can strain the lower back if proper core engagement is neglected. To mitigate this, brace your core during the exercise and avoid locking your knees at the top of the movement. Additionally, relying solely on the leg press can lead to muscle imbalances, as it doesn’t engage stabilizing muscles as effectively as free-weight exercises. Incorporate bodyweight squats or lunges into your routine to complement machine work and ensure holistic lower body strength.
For those seeking progressive results, vary your routine by experimenting with foot placement and tempo. Narrow stances increase quadriceps activation, while wider stances target the inner thighs and glutes. Slowing the eccentric (lowering) phase of the movement enhances muscle endurance and hypertrophy. Track your progress by incrementally increasing weight or repetitions weekly, ensuring consistent challenge without plateauing. With consistent practice, the leg press machine can be a cornerstone of your lower body regimen, delivering strength gains and muscular definition efficiently and safely.
